About This Watch

The Audemars Piguet Royal Oak 15500OR in rose gold with black "Grande Tapisserie" dial on leather strap combines the warmth of precious metal with a dark, sophisticated dial for maximum visual impact. The contrast between the warm rose gold case and the deep black tapisserie dial is striking, creating a watch that commands attention without being flashy. The leather strap gives this variant a dressier character compared to the bracelet models, making it suitable for formal occasions while retaining the sporty Royal Oak DNA. The caliber 4302 delivers a 70-hour power reserve with the precision expected of AP's in-house movements. At 41mm, the case size provides comfortable proportions, and the reduced weight compared to a full bracelet model makes it remarkably comfortable. The alternating brushed and polished surfaces on the rose gold case are finished to the same exacting standards as the steel versions, requiring hundreds of hours of hand labor per case. The 15500OR on strap has been praised for its versatility and elegance, appealing to collectors who want a Royal Oak for dressier occasions or who prefer the comfort of a leather strap.

In-Depth Review

# The Rose Gold Royal Oak 15500OR: Luxury Sports Watchmaking at a Crossroads

When Audemars Piguet discontinued the 15500OR in rose gold, it marked the end of an era for one of watchmaking's most consequential designs. The Royal Oak's octagonal bezel, integrated bracelet, and "Grande Tapisserie" dial have remained virtually unchanged since Gérald Genta's 1972 debut, yet this particular iteration—with its 41mm case, modernized AP 4302 caliber, and 70-hour power reserve—represented the collection's most refined expression before the 2022 transition to the 16650. The black dial version on brown alligator leather struck an unusual balance: sporty enough for daily wear, precious enough in 18k rose gold to demand respect in any room. The 10.4mm case thickness and 50-meter water resistance underscore that this remains a sports watch first, despite its $40,100 retail positioning.

The 15500OR appeals primarily to established collectors who recognize the distinction between trend-driven luxury and timeless design. This watch suits the executive who wants a statement timepiece without resorting to dive watches or chronographs, and the enthusiast who understands that discontinued references hold their value differently than current production models. At current market prices near $55,000, however, buyers should consider competitors like the Patek Philippe Nautilus 5711 or Rolex Day-Date in white gold, both of which offer stronger price stability and broader market recognition. The 15500OR's value proposition ultimately rests on personal conviction: whether its design heritage justifies the premium, and whether its discontinued status enhances or complicates the investment thesis.

Specifications

Movement

Movement TypeAutomatic
CaliberAP 4302
Power Reserve70 hours
Frequency28,800 vph
Jewels32

Case

Case Diameter41.0mm
Case Thickness10.4mm
Case Material18k Rose Gold
CrystalSapphire
BezelFixed, octagonal with exposed screws
Dial ColorBlack "Grande Tapisserie"
Lug-to-Lug47.0mm

Features

Water Resistance50m / 164ft
Bracelet/StrapBrown alligator leather strap
ClaspAP folding clasp in rose gold
Weight110g
Complications
Date
